Applications
2,6-Dimethyl-3-heptanone (CAS 19549-83-8) is primarily used as a fragrance ingredient in perfumery and cosmetics, imparting fruity and green notes. It is also evaluated and used as an aroma component in food flavorings at limited levels and serves as an intermediate in industrial chemical synthesis for preparing other compounds. In household products, it can function as a fragrance additive in cleaners and air fresheners.
